Cost Range for Storm Window Replacement - The typical cost for replacing storm windows varies between $200 and $600 per window, depending on size and material choices. Larger or custom-sized storm windows tend to be on the higher end of this range.
Factors Influencing Cost - Expenses can fluctuate based on the type of storm window selected, such as aluminum or vinyl frames, and whether the installation requires additional work. Expect costs to increase with complexity or custom features.
Average Project Expenses - For a standard home in Southlake, TX, replacing all storm windows might cost between $1,500 and $4,500. This estimate includes multiple windows and basic installation services from local providers.
Additional Cost Considerations - Costs may vary depending on the number of windows, accessibility, and whether any repairs are needed prior to installation. Contact local service providers for precise quotes tailored to specific properties.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m window replacement services? Storm window replacement services involve installing new storm windows to improve insulation, reduce energy costs, and enhance home protection against harsh weather conditions.
How do I know if my storm windows need replacing? Signs include difficulty opening or closing, visible damage or gaps, condensation between panes, or decreased energy efficiency.
What should I consider when choosing new storm windows? Factors include material durability, insulation properties, compatibility with existing windows, and local weather conditions.
How long does storm window repl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the number of windows and complexity, but most projects can be completed within a day or two.
